NAVER D2SF-backed Nota AI Lists on KOSDAQ, Embarking on Global Expansion in AI Model Compression and Optimization
The Manila Times· 2025-11-03 01:32
Core Insights - Nota AI, backed by NAVER D2SF, has successfully listed on the KOSDAQ market, showcasing its growth potential in AI model compression and optimization technologies [1][3] - The company has achieved significant annual revenue growth through collaborations with industry leaders such as NVIDIA, Samsung Electronics, and Qualcomm [3][5] Company Overview - Nota AI specializes in AI lightweighting and optimization technology, which is gaining global attention for its ability to reduce operational costs associated with high-performance AI models [4][5] - The company's proprietary AI model optimization platform, 'NetsPresso®,' and on-device AI solutions enhance its technological competitiveness [4][5] Financial Performance - Nota AI's revenue more than doubled from approximately $2.52 million in 2023 to approximately $5.89 million in 2024, with a target of approximately $10.17 million for 2025 [8] Strategic Focus - Post-IPO, Nota AI aims to enhance its AI optimization technology and expand into new markets, particularly targeting global semiconductor companies and device manufacturers in the U.S., Europe, and the Middle East [7] - The company plans to invest heavily in developing a next-generation platform for optimizing a wider variety of AI models and expects strategic collaborations to drive sales growth in high-growth sectors like defense and aerospace [7] Market Recognition - Nota AI was recognized as one of the '2025 Global Innovative AI Startups 100' by CB Insights, highlighting its innovative capabilities in the AI sector [5]
AI最新的“风口职位”:前沿部署工程师
Hua Er Jie Jian Wen· 2025-11-03 01:23
Group 1 - The core viewpoint of the articles highlights the rising demand for Frontline Deployment Engineers (FDEs) in the AI industry as companies seek to leverage advanced AI technologies for business applications [1][2] - Major AI companies like OpenAI, Anthropic, and Cohere are actively recruiting FDEs to accelerate the commercialization of their AI models and drive revenue growth [1][2] - The job postings for customer-facing AI positions have surged over 800% from January to September 2025, indicating explosive market demand [1] Group 2 - FDEs serve a dual role as technical experts and business consultants, helping companies across various sectors, including manufacturing and healthcare, effectively implement AI tools and achieve return on investment [2] - The approach of embedding FDEs within client organizations allows for a tailored understanding of unique needs, leading to customized AI solutions [2] - Palantir pioneered the FDE concept in the commercial sector, with FDEs now comprising about half of its workforce, demonstrating the model's effectiveness in delivering tangible business value [3] Group 3 - The collaboration between OpenAI's FDE team and agricultural machinery manufacturer John Deere resulted in a 60% to 70% reduction in pesticide usage, showcasing the practical benefits of the FDE model [3] - Insights gained from real-world applications not only address client needs but also enhance OpenAI's own research and product development [3]
Alphabet is increasingly launching “moonshot” projects as independent companies — here's why
TechCrunch· 2025-11-03 01:02
Core Insights - Alphabet's X is evolving its strategy by spinning out ambitious technology projects as independent companies rather than keeping them within the Alphabet structure [1][3] - The new approach is supported by a dedicated venture fund, Series X Capital, which has raised over $500 million and is legally obligated to invest exclusively in X spinouts [2][11] - X's definition of a moonshot includes solving significant global problems, proposing innovative solutions, and leveraging breakthrough technology [5][13] Spinout Strategy - The spinout strategy allows X to detach projects from Alphabet, enabling faster development for certain projects that may not benefit from being part of the larger corporate structure [3][9] - Series X Capital, managed by Gideon Yu, allows Alphabet to be a minority investor, facilitating a more flexible investment approach [2][11] - This strategy addresses the challenge of finding outside investors willing to take over majority stakes in projects, streamlining the spinout process while maintaining strategic ties [11][12] Intellectual Honesty and Project Evaluation - X promotes a culture of intellectual honesty, actively celebrating the termination of projects that do not meet their rigorous standards [4][10] - The lab employs a testing approach that seeks to identify reasons to shut down projects early, resulting in a low hit rate of 2%, which is viewed as a feature rather than a failure [10] - Employees are incentivized to detach from their ideas, allowing for more objective evaluations of project viability [9][12] Recent Developments - In 2025, X has successfully spun out companies such as Taara and Heritable Agriculture, focusing on innovative technologies in wireless communication and biotech [12] - The latest moonshot announced is Anori, an AI platform aimed at addressing complexities in the real estate and construction industries, highlighting the significant environmental impact of the built environment [13][14]
